KfW IPEX-Bank finances TT-Line’s LNG-powered ferry

Frankfurt-based KfW IPEX-Bank is providing financing for the German shipping company TT-Line’s LNG dual-fuel RoPax ferry, Nils Holgersson.

The bank said in a statement on Wednesday it would provide 30 million euros ($31.9 million) for the “Green Ship”.

In April, TT-Line started using this LNG-powered vessel in the Baltic Sea.

Prior to that, China Merchants Jinling Shipyard in Nanjing delivered the 230 meters long vessel to the owner during a ceremony held on March 7.

TT-Line also took delivery of the sister ship, Peter Pan, in November.

Both of the vessels feature MAN dual-fuel engines and two 500-cbm type C LNG tanks, according to TT-Line.

The ships, based on TT-Line’s ‘Green Ship’ design, have the capacity for about 800 passengers and over 200 vehicles, and will both work in the Baltic Sea.
